Mee‐Jung Han is a scholar working on Molecular Biology, Spectroscopy and Genetics. According to data from OpenAlex, Mee‐Jung Han has authored 34 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Molecular Biology, 12 papers in Spectroscopy and 12 papers in Genetics. Recurrent topics in Mee‐Jung Han’s work include Advanced Proteomics Techniques and Applications (12 papers), Bacterial Genetics and Biotechnology (12 papers) and Enzyme Structure and Function (8 papers). Mee‐Jung Han is often cited by papers focused on Advanced Proteomics Techniques and Applications (12 papers), Bacterial Genetics and Biotechnology (12 papers) and Enzyme Structure and Function (8 papers). Mee‐Jung Han collaborates with scholars based in South Korea and United States. Mee‐Jung Han's co-authors include Sang Yup Lee, Jong‐Shin Yoo, Sung Ho Yoon, Ki Jun Jeong, Sang Sun Yoon, Xiao‐Xia Xia, Jin Young Kim, Jeong Wook Lee, Yu‐Sin Jang and Joungmin Lee and has published in prestigious journals such as Applied and Environmental Microbiology, Scientific Reports and Journal of Bacteriology.
